Definitions:

Classical Conditioning

A habituation technique that involves repeatedly combining two stimuli, eventually resulting in a response first provoked by the second stimulus being provoked by the first stimulus alone.

Conditioned Stimulus

A stimulus that, after association with an unconditioned stimulus, comes to produce a conditioned response.

Conditioned Response

A learned response to a previously neutral stimulus that has become associated with another stimulus.

Extinction

In the field of psychology, the slow reduction and eventual vanishing of a learned response when the previously associated conditioned stimulus is not presented together with the unconditioned stimulus anymore.
